ILLINOIS DIVISION E-COMMERCE FIELD SPECIALIST Peoria, IL, United States

Job Description Provide support to the division eCommerce manager by ensuring procedures and company guidelines are followed to achieve sales objectives, goals and budgets. Assist in the training and development of the stores' eCommerce team. Demonstrate the company's core values of respect, honesty, integrity, diversity, inclusion and safety.

Responsibilities

Support the implementation, training and execution of new initiatives and process improvements to support division and company goals

Ensure that division eCommerce departments are meeting and exceeding customer expectations for ease of shopping, variety, freshness and cleanliness

Ensure that local, state, and federal laws, food safety procedures and company guidelines are followed

Assist in recruiting, selecting and hiring qualified associates for division eCommerce departments and ensure stores are sufficiently staffed to handle business demands

Participate in delivering training to the division's eCommerce team for all eCommerce functions and duties at new and existing locations

Assist store eCommerce teams in achieving annual division performance goals for quality, efficiency, and positive customer experiences

Assist store eCommerce teams in meeting division and expense budgets

Assist in the eCommerce department's analysis and response to the competitive landscape

Communicate the eCommerce strategy with division district managers, district coordinators, store eCommerce supervisors and associates

Work with the store eCommerce team and division staff on resolving operational issues

Assist with addressing customer feedback, questions, or concerns

Visit store eCommerce sites to assist teams in maintaining operational and customer service standards; address immediate concerns and work with team to provide solutions to issues

Ensure preventive maintenance protocols for equipment are being followed

Measure productivity and customer satisfaction levels for store eCommerce department associates; assist store eCommerce supervisor in creating continuous improvement plans

Assist with addressing customer feedback inquiries, questions or concerns

Must be able to perform the essential job functions of this position with or without reasonable accommodation

Qualifications Minimum

High School Diploma or GED

Any proven supervisory experience

1 year of experience as an assistant store lead

Excellent oral/written communication skills

Ability to stoop, kneel, or crouch several times per hour

Must be able to stand for extended periods of time and/or walk constantly

Must be able to lift objects up to 25 pounds frequently and objects up to 50 pounds several times throughout the day

Basic knowledge of computers

Strong organizational and leadership skills

Desired

Bachelor's Degree

Any retail management experience

Any experience with and knowledge of point of sale (POS)

Any experience in a warehouse environment

Knowledge of eCommerce business
